Block 963,523
Block Hash
e0b4aed501e5bcab9b702785948c3dab50fa62bc3f817180d102c2a2c8
b30b91
Previous Block Hash
54c35112c76206e18b50fe5caae00a68d7a2ec9db6f8f2231c80029ab6 3c0b61
Mined
Transactions
4
Difficulty
23.13 M
Size
848 bytes
Transactions (4)
1 input, 1 output
10,000.02712
PEPE
1 input, 2 outputs
820,303.488127
PEPE
1 input, 2 outputs
150,540.417396
PEPE
1 input, 2 outputs
178,902.91106
PEPE